Colombian crashes out of Australian Open

Colombia’s Santiago Giraldo has lost in straight sets to Croatian Marin Cilic in the second round of the Australian Open tennis match in Melbourne.

The 23-year-old Colombian matched his 2010 performance at the first Grand Slam event of the year by reaching the second round but could not find a way past the six foot six inch Croatian, who is the 15th seed and reached the semi-finals at this event last year.

The final score was 6-1 7-6 6-3, as Giraldo, the world No. 59, rallied in the second set but ultimately could not find a breakthrough.

Giraldo’s exit means that there are no more Colombians left in the draw following Alejandro Falla’s straight sets defeat to Feliciano Lopez in the first round.
